Output 51cf7900c22e94ec9702de7ccf3ce90d0afed5fad2aa9b47a31bcb18f9381729:0

value
2839703
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9498f2be89ad338139b65904ccb73f4d2e69a80b OP_EQUAL
address
3FEj9xpic3KF98rxfgNqjxL5MSSCnxZHb4
transaction
51cf7900c22e94ec9702de7ccf3ce90d0afed5fad2aa9b47a31bcb18f9381729